Base De Datos
Keeli14 de Junio de 2014
729 Palabras (3 Páginas)184 Visitas
Antes de conocer temas importantes de una Base de datos, debemos de conocer su definición; lo cual se dice que una base de datos es una entidad en la cual se pueden almacenar datos de manera estructurada, con la menor redundancia posible. Diferentes programas y diferentes usuarios deben poder utilizar estos datos. Por lo tanto, el concepto de base de datos generalmente está relacionado con el de red ya que se debe poder compartir esta información. De allí el término base.
Pero ¿Por qué utilizar una base de datos? Pues una base de datos proporciona a los usuarios el acceso a datos, que pueden visualizar, ingresar o actualizar, en concordancia con los derechos de acceso que se les hayan otorgado.
Una base de datos puede ser local, es decir que puede utilizarla sólo un usuario en un equipo, o puede ser distribuida, es decir que la información se almacena en equipos remotos y se puede acceder a ella a través de una red.
Una de las principales ventajas de utilizar bases de datos es que múltiples usuarios pueden acceder a ellas al mismo tiempo y además provoca menos trabajo laborioso, ya que se ahorra trabajo de llevar a mano los registros.
La independencia lógica de los datos se refiere a la inmunidad de las aplicaciones de usuario a los cambios en la estructura lógica de la base de datos. Esto permite que un cambio en la definición de un esquema no debe afectar a las aplicaciones de usuario. Y la independencia física de los datos se refiere al ocultamiento de los detalles sobre las estructuras de almacenamiento a las aplicaciones de usuario.
La base de datos contiene una arquitectura que se divide en tres niveles los cuales son: El nivel interno que tiene que ver con la forma de almacenamiento de los datos físicamente, el nivel externo, es el que tiene que ver como los usuarios individuales ven los datos y el nivel conceptual es un nivel de indirección entre los otros dos. Además de estos tres niveles, debemos tomar en cuenta las transformaciones que hay entre cada nivel, las cuales son la Transformación conceptual/interna, que define la correspondencia entre la vista conceptual y la base de datos almacenada y especifica cómo están representados los registros y campos conceptuales en el nivel interno y la Transformación externa/conceptual, define la correspondencia entre una vista externa y la vista conceptual.
Es importante además conocer sobre el administrador de datos y el administrador de base de datos, que aunque suene parecido no cumplen las mismas funciones.
Puesto que el administrador de datos es la persona que tendrá la responsabilidad central sobre los datos dentro de la empresa, ya que es el encargado de decidir qué datos serán almacenados y establecer políticas.
En cambio el administrador de la base de datos es el técnico profesional responsable de implementar las decisiones del administrador de datos, ya que es la persona que crea la base de datos y conoce todo sobre el tema.
Se debe conocer que el sistema de gestión de bases de datos es esencial para el adecuado funcionamiento y manipulación de los datos contenidos en la base. Se puede definir como: El Conjunto de programas, procedimientos, lenguajes, etc. que suministra, tanto a los usuarios no informáticos como a los analistas, programadores o al administrador, los medios necesarios para describir, recuperar y manipular los datos almacenados en la base, manteniendo su integridad, confidencialidad y seguridad.
El siguiente documento deja una muestra de la importancia que tiene el saber manejar, usar y administrar una base de datos, sin embargo se hace necesario conocer cómo se puede beneficiar el usuario de ella; sin dejar de lado las normas que se deben seguir para evitar que existan inconsistencias y fluyan todos sus defectos.
De esta manera se puede decir que el manejo de una base de datos y la creación no es trabajo de una sola
...